M193, 55g fmj
M855, 62g mild steel penetrator (green tip) relatively common, available in bulk, frowned upon in indoor and some outdoor ranges. and its more expensive than m193
M855 A1, 62g hardened steel penetrator, not being produced for the public....
MK262 mod 1, 77g SMK, not being produced for the public, but similar load from IMI and black hills are favored by many.

General public has always followed military guns and cartridges, and they like what cheap, 55g fmj was produced in bulk, cheap, and available to the public, are your really surprised it stuck?
